I read that somewhere too to bring that bottle... the thing is: is it really necessary?? can you just wash with your hand with the cleaning liquids/ like daily cleaning procedure..
 
You don't "need" it but it is very convenient especially when everything (body, shoulders, pelvic bone, wound) hurts and you are using public toilets.... It helps you to clean your wound very easily after each bathroom use... And really you just need to rinse with water... And will be very tricky to get water from tap to wash your wound with your pants down over the toilet without getting dirty or making a mess
